Course Details

Introduction to Epidemiology of Immigrant Health: Defining immigrant health, identifying key concepts in epidemiology, and understanding the importance of studying the epidemiology of immigrant health. • Migrant Population Dynamics: Examining global migration patterns, demographic characteristics, and social determinants of health impacting immigrant populations. • Health Disparities in Immigrant Communities: Analyzing health inequities, access to healthcare services, and cultural barriers experienced by immigrants. • Infectious Diseases and Immigrant Health: Investigating the spread, prevention, and control of infectious diseases within immigrant communities, including tuberculosis, HIV/AIDS, and COVID-19. • Non-Communicable Diseases and Immigrant Health: Evaluating the burden of non-communicable diseases, such as cardiovascular disease, diabetes, and cancer, among immigrant populations. • Mental Health of Immigrants: Recognizing the prevalence, risk factors, and protective factors associated with mental health disorders in immigrant communities. • Public Health Policy and Immigrant Health: Assessing current policies and proposing evidence-based interventions to address health disparities in immigrant populations. • Research Methods in Immigrant Health Epidemiology: Developing skills in data collection, analysis, and interpretation for immigrant health research. • Global Health Governance and Immigrant Health: Exploring the roles of international organizations, governments, and civil society in promoting and protecting immigrant health.
